Shutter Staining Questions
What causes shutter staining? Shutter staining is typically caused by prolonged exposure to moisture, dirt, or environmental pollutants, leading to discoloration or buildup on the shutter surfaces.
Can shutter staining be removed? Yes, staining can often be cleaned or treated to improve appearance, depending on the severity and type of stain present.
Are certain shutter materials more prone to staining? Materials like wood and metal can be more susceptible to staining, especially if they are exposed to moisture or corrosive elements over time.
How can staining be prevented? Regular cleaning and maintenance, along with protective coatings, can help reduce the risk of staining on shutters.
